Improper nutrition or insufficient calcium early in your dogs life, as well as worms and other parasites that may rob your puppys body of nutrition, can also result in ears not growing properly. Since the ears are made of cartilage, you can stimulate good cartilage development by a quality diet, rich in proteins and vitamin C. Another thing that can help in building cartilage is Vitamin C. Although dogs are able to produce their own vitamin C ( unlike humans) its recommended to feed them with whole food that contains this valuable vitamin.
